Germination/Propagation Top

Suggest a correction or add new data!
Maintain seeds at 20°C for 3 months, then transfer to 4°C for another 3 months.
Pulpy Coat Inhibits Germination: Seeds with a pulpy or fleshy outer coat need to have this material removed by soaking and rinsing in clean water daily for about a week. The inhibitory substances in the pulp are thus washed away, and germination rates improve.
protect from rodents
